• DocumentCode
    568603
  • Title

    A Survey of Microarchitecture Support for Embedded Processor Security

  • Author

    Kanuparthi, Arun K. ; Karri, Ramesh ; Ormazabal, Gaston ; Addepalli, Sateesh K.

  • Author_Institution
    Polytech. Inst., New York Univ., New York, NY, USA
  • fYear
    2012
  • fDate
    19-21 Aug. 2012
  • Firstpage
    368
  • Lastpage
    373
  • Abstract
    The number of attacks on embedded processors is on the rise. Attackers exploit vulnerabilities in the software to launch new attacks and get unauthorized access to sensitive information stored in these devices. Several solutions have been proposed by both the academia and the industry to protect the programs running on these embedded-processor based computer systems. After a description of the several attacks that threaten a computer system, this paper surveys existing defenses - software-based and hardware-based (watchdog checkers, integrity trees, memory encryption, and modification of processor architecture), that protect against such attacks. This paper also provides a comparative discussion of their advantages and disadvantages.
  • Keywords
    authorisation; data integrity; embedded systems; microprocessor chips; computer system; embedded processor security; embedded processors attacks; embedded-processor-based computer systems; hardware-based defenses; microarchitecture support; programs protection; software vulnerabilities; software-based defenses; unauthorized access; Computer architecture; Computers; Cryptography; Hardware; Runtime; Software; Dynamic Integrity Checking; Embedded Processors; Hardware Security; Microarchitecture Support;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    VLSI (ISVLSI), 2012 IEEE Computer Society Annual Symposium on
  • Conference_Location
    Amherst, MA
  • ISSN
    2159-3469
  • Print_ISBN
    978-1-4673-2234-8
  • Type

    conf

  • DOI
    10.1109/ISVLSI.2012.64
  • Filename
    6296501